Get PriceGrey water treatment with a membrane bio-reactor (MBR) is equally effective and leads to the disinfection of the effluent. The constructed wetland requires a large base area; therefore, conventional wastewater treatment plants should be used for grey water treatment in large settlements.

Get PriceThis study reviewed greywater characteristics, treatment systems, reuse strategies and perception of greywater reuse among users. It shows that there is a wide variation in greywater characteristics and volume generation rates which is largely dependent on the water use, lifestyle patterns and type of settlement.

Get Price1. Introduction. Grey water is defined as the urban wastewater that includes water from baths, showers, hand basins, washing machines, dishwashers and kitchen sinks, but excludes streams from toilets (Jefferson et al., 1999, Otterpohl et al., 1999, Eriksson, 2002, Ottoson and Stenström, 2003).Some authors exclude kitchen wastewater from the other grey water streams (Al-Jayyousi, 2003

Get PriceAnaerobic Treatment in Decentralised and Source-Separation-Based Sanitation Concepts | SpringerLink. Anaerobic digestion of wastewater should be a core technology employed in decentralised sanitation systems especially when their objective is also resource conservation and reuse. The most efficient system involves separate collection and anaerobic digestion of the most concentrated domestic wastewater streams: black or brown water and solid fraction of kitchen waste.
